To select a row, hover your cursor near the left border of the table until it becomes a right-pointing arrow; then left-click. The keyboard shortcut is Shift + Space. 2. Selecting the Entire Table. To select the data for the entire table, you can press Ctrl + A. high quality chocolate for baking

WebIn Cell A1 I put the formula =Cell("row") Row 2 is completely empty; Row 3 contains the headers; Row 4 and down is the data; To make the formula in A1 to be updated, the sheet need to recalculate. I can do that with F9, but I created the Selection_Change event with the only code to be executed is Range("A1").Calculate. This way it is done every ... WebClick File > Options. In the Advanced category, under Editing options, select or clear the Enable fill handle and cell drag-and-drop check box. Note: To help prevent replacing existing data when you drag the fill handle, make sure that the Alert before overwriting cells check box is selected. WebMar 21, 2024 · Select the inputted data. WebSep 12, 2024 · Highlighting the Entire Row and Column that Contain the Active Cell The following code example clears the color in all the cells on the worksheet by setting the ColorIndex property equal to 0, and then highlights the entire row and column that contain the active cell by using the EntireRow and EntireColumn properties.
